Question 1: How can art be used to create a more welcoming environment for patients?
Answer: Art can transform clinical spaces into healing havens. Consider displaying artwork that evokes feelings of serenity, such as landscapes, nature scenes, or abstract pieces. Encourage patients to express themselves through art therapy or by showcasing their artwork in their rooms.
Question 2: What are some ways to use art to reduce stress and promote relaxation among nurses?
Answer: Create a dedicated art space where nurses can engage in creative activities during breaks. Offer art supplies and encourage them to express their emotions through painting, drawing, or crafting. Incorporate music therapy sessions to promote relaxation and mindfulness.
Question 3: How can art be used to educate patients about their health conditions?
Answer: Visual aids, such as anatomical illustrations or diagrams, can help patients understand complex medical concepts more easily. Use art to create educational posters or brochures that provide information about diseases, treatments, and healthy lifestyle choices.
Question 4: What are some creative ways to use art to celebrate cultural diversity among patients and staff?
Answer: Organize art exhibitions showcasing the cultural heritage of different ethnic groups represented in your patient population and staff. Encourage staff to share their cultural traditions through art and music, fostering a sense of inclusivity and appreciation.
Question 5: How can art be used to facilitate communication between healthcare professionals and patients?
Answer: Art can bridge the gap between healthcare providers and patients. Encourage patients to express their feelings, concerns, and experiences through art, which can provide valuable insights for healthcare professionals. Use art as a starting point for conversations, fostering empathy and understanding.
Question 6: What are some ways to involve the community in art-based initiatives within the healthcare setting?
Answer: Collaborate with local artists, schools, and community organizations to create art projects that benefit the healthcare environment. Organize art workshops, exhibitions, and performances that engage the community and raise awareness about the healing power of art.

Tips for Incorporating Art into Nursing Care
Introduction:
As you embark on your journey of art appreciation in nursing, here are four practical tips to help you successfully integrate art into your practice and reap its benefits:
Tip 1: Start Small:
Begin by introducing small touches of art into your workplace. Display a piece of artwork in your office or workspace, or hang a nature poster in a patient's room. These subtle additions can have a positive impact on the overall atmosphere.
Tip 2: Encourage Patient Expression:
Provide opportunities for patients to express themselves creatively. Offer art supplies and encourage them to draw, paint, or engage in other art forms. Their artwork can serve as a window into their emotions and experiences, facilitating better communication and understanding.
Tip 3: Collaborate with Local Artists:
Reach out to local artists and explore opportunities for collaboration. Invite them to display their artwork in your healthcare setting or conduct art workshops for patients and staff. These partnerships can bring fresh perspectives and enrich the artistic landscape of your workplace.
Tip 4: Use Art as a Teaching Tool:
Incorporate art into patient education. Use visual aids, such as diagrams or illustrations, to explain complex medical concepts in a more engaging and accessible manner. Art can also be used to promote healthy lifestyle choices and disease prevention.
